Many communes and wards in Hanoi are focusing maximum manpower and vehicles to implement the 45-day peak campaign to complete the land database.

According to the plan, Yen Nghia ward, Hanoi city will focus on reviewing, updating, standardizing and cleaning land data according to the criteria "right - sufficient - clean - living"; and at the same time closely coordinate with Ha Dong Branch of the Land Registration Office, Ward Police and related units to verify and standardize land user information according to personal identification codes, ensuring accurate, unified and synchronous data.

To effectively implement the campaign, Yen Nghia Ward People's Committee has established a steering committee and working groups, mobilizing the participation of professional departments, residential groups, socio-political organizations and functional forces in the area.

With the motto "going through each alley, knocking on each house, checking each person", the working groups will directly guide and support people in the process of collecting, updating and verifying information.

Yen Nghia Ward People's Committee requests households, individuals and organizations currently using land in the area to proactively coordinate with the working group when notified to work.

Prepare a citizen identification card and the original of one of the land documents such as a land use right certificate, land allocation decision, Certificate of land registration or carry out declaration according to the instruction form for cases where there are no related documents.

In particular, people only need to provide original documents for comparison, taking photos, and scanning data as required by the working group and do not have to photocopy any types of documents.

To make the campaign effective, Huong Son Commune People's Committee also requested households, individuals, organizations and businesses in the area to actively coordinate with working groups in the process of reviewing, collecting and updating land data.

Accordingly, land users need to proactively provide copies or create conditions for members of the working group to scan and photograph land use right certificates, citizen identification cards and documents related to the origin of land use as required.

For land plots that have not been granted land use right certificates, the Commune People's Committee requests people to urgently carry out initial land declaration and registration according to the guidance of professional officials.

At the same time, people are encouraged to use the VNeID application to provide information and photocopies of Land Use Right Certificates according to instructions, thereby contributing to shortening the time to collect dossiers and speeding up the process of digitizing land data in the area.

In the process of implementation, the commune's working groups will conduct reviews according to the motto "going through each alley, knocking on each house, checking each person", ensuring no cases are missed. All land plots in the area, including residential land, agricultural land and non-agricultural land, must be inspected, identified, positioned, and accurately identified, and fully updated on cadastral maps and land database systems.
